Siamese Cats: The Chatty Companions You Didn’t Know You Needed
Welcome to the fascinating world of Siamese cats, where sleek elegance meets an unparalleled vocal charm. Known for their striking blue almond-shaped eyes and pointy ears, these felines stand out with their unique coat patterns. Their fur is typically light-colored on the body, with darker hues on the face, ears, paws, and tail – a trait known as ‘colorpoint’. But what truly sets Siamese cats apart is their remarkable ability to communicate. They are among the chattiest of all cat breeds, often engaging their human companions in what seems like a never-ending conversation.
A Brief History of Siamese Cats
The origins of the Siamese cat can be traced back to Siam, now known as Thailand. These elegant creatures were once revered in royal courts and were considered sacred. Legends tell of Siamese cats guarding precious relics, their tails wrapped around the objects to keep them warm. It wasn’t until the late 19th century that Siamese cats made their way to Western countries, first appearing in England and then spreading across Europe and North America. Today, they are one of the most popular cat breeds globally, cherished for their striking appearance and engaging personalities.
Intelligence and Social Behavior
Siamese cats are incredibly intelligent, often outsmarting even the most astute humans. They are curious and enjoy exploring their surroundings, always seeking new experiences. This curiosity makes them excellent problem solvers; they can learn tricks, play fetch, and even open doors if given the chance. Their high level of intelligence also means they require mental stimulation to stay happy and healthy.
Siamese cats are highly social animals, forming strong bonds with their human families. They thrive on interaction and can become quite attached to their owners. Unlike many other cat breeds, Siamese cats enjoy being around people and often follow their humans from room to room, seeking attention and companionship. They are known to be affectionate and may even greet their owners at the door when they return home.
Tips for Potential Owners
Siamese cats are not just about looks; they need proper care and attention to thrive. Here are some tips for those considering bringing a Siamese cat into their home:
- Provide Mental Stimulation: Siamese cats need plenty of toys and activities to keep their minds engaged. Puzzle feeders, interactive games, and regular play sessions can help prevent boredom and destructive behavior.
- Create a Safe Environment: Given their curiosity and intelligence, it’s important to ensure your home is safe for your Siamese cat. Keep toxic substances out of reach, secure windows, and provide access to high perches for exploration.
- Encourage Vocal Interaction: Siamese cats love to talk, so engage with them through verbal communication. Respond to their meows, and consider teaching them simple commands or tricks.
- Offer Plenty of Affection: Siamese cats crave attention and affection. Spend quality time with your cat, petting them, grooming them, and simply enjoying their company.
- Regular Vet Visits: Like any pet, Siamese cats need routine veterinary care to maintain their health. Schedule regular check-ups and vaccinations, and address any health concerns promptly.
